Analysis
In 2025, long working hours in the main job by professional status and in Poland stood at 6.6. That is the lowest value across all 25 years on record.
The figure is down 5.7% on the previous year and down 49.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, long working hours in the main job by professional status and in Poland peaked at 18.1 in 2004 and was at its lowest, 6.6, in 2025.
Poland ranks 13th of 35 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 25 years of available data.
